Maltodextrin is often called N-Zorbit M, Tapioca Maltodextrin, Malto or Maltosec. It's a sweet polysaccharide and natural food additive produced from grain starch. In America it is mostly developed from corn, but it really may also be produced from rice, potatoes and tapioca. In Europe maltodextrin is usually derived from wheat. The starch goes by way of a system identified as partial hydrolysis, which uses drinking water, enzymes and acids to make a water-soluble white powder. Interestingly, the partial hydrolysis method leaves maltodextrin with lower than 20 per cent sugar information.

Generating maltodextrin is commonly a somewhat elaborate enterprise. Chemists ordinarily begin with a pure starch; potato is a standard case in point, but corn, wheat, go here and barley can even be applied. The starch have to be lowered to its basic parts, commonly by combining it with drinking water in the method referred to as hydrolysis.
